Abu Dhabi rolls out draft recommendations for NFT trading

840 aHR0cHM6Ly9zMy5jb2ludGVsZWdyYXBoLmNvbS91cGxvYWRzLzIwMjItMDMvMWIxMTkxZjItNmYxMy00OWJkLWE0MGQtYzIyNGFjZTllMmM1LmpwZw ciou2A

The emirate’s special economic zone might grant licensed exchanges the right to trade nonfungible tokens.
Abu Dhabi Global Market (ADGM), the emirate’s free zone, published a consultation paper on March 21 titled “Proposals for enhancements to capital markets and virtual assets in ADGM.” The document contains draft guidelines that, among other asset classes, cover nonfungible token (NFT) trading. The paper proposes that companies with a license from the free zone’s financial regulator be allowed to facilitate NFT trading.Along with sections dedicated to traditional financial instruments, the document contains a little more than a page on virtual assets and NFTs.
